How much does an Electric and Gas Operations Superintendent make?

As of March 01, 2025, the average annual salary for an Electric and Gas Operations Superintendent in the United States is $119,701. According to Salary.com, salaries can range from a low of $103,867 to a high of $136,156, with most professionals earning between $111,413 and $128,314.

How Does Experience Level Affect an Electric and Gas Operations Superintendent's Salary?

An entry-level Electric and Gas Operations Superintendent with less than 1 year of experience earns about $116,608. With 1-2 years of experience, the average salary increases to $116,980. For 2-4 years of experience, the pay typically rises to $117,845. Senior-level professionals with 5-8 years of experience earn around $118,835, and those with over 8 years of experience can expect an average of $119,958.

How much does salary of Electric and Gas Operations Superintendent vary from state to state?

How much does salary of Electric and Gas Operations Superintendent vary from city to city?

Salaries in the United States can vary greatly between cities due to factors like cost of living, local economies, and industry presence.

For example, as of March 01, 2025:
  • In San Francisco, CA, the average yearly salary for an Electric and Gas Operations Superintendent is $149,626.
  • In New York, NY, the average annual salary is $139,811.
  • In Boston, MA, an Electric and Gas Operations Superintendent earns $134,185 per year.

5. What are the responsibilities of Electric and Gas Operations Superintendent?

Responsible for managing work crews involved in construction, maintenance, and repair of electric and gas distribution systems. Plans and monitors work loads through crew supervisors. May require a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a manager or head of a unit/department. Typically manages through subordinate managers and professionals in larger groups of moderate complexity. Provides input to strategic decisions that affect the functional area of responsibility. May give input into developing the budget. Typically requires 3+ years of managerial experience. Capable of resolving escalated issues arising from operations and requiring coordination with other departments.
